What kind of job could i get from a BA in spanish, portuguese and italian?
Asked by Jack
I am currently studying spanish portuguese and italian language, aswell as culture, politics, history and litreature. I was wondering , apart from teaching, what jobs would i be suited to? Would being fluent in all 3 languages be an advantage for any particular job/ attractive to a certain type of emplpyer?

A:
Best Answer:
Look into obtaining a 2-year paralegal certificate with a specialty in immigration law. With your language skills coupled with legal training, you can pretty much dictate your salary range. Good luck!
